Geographic Area: Danbury, Connecticut Click here for Danbury, CT Census Data By ZipCode     
 
Subject Number Percent   Subject Number Percent
          Total housing units       OCCUPANTS PER ROOM
   
UNITS IN STRUCTURE                 Occupied housing units 27,183 100.0
1-unit, detached 12,078 44.4   1.00 or less 25,225 92.8
1-unit, attached 2,064 7.6   1.01 to 1.50 1,078 4.0
2 units 3,255 12.0   1.51 or more 880 3.2
3 or 4 units 3,302 12.1        
5 to 9 units 2,164 8.0             Specified owner-occupied units 11,779 100.0
10 to 19 units 1,281 4.7   VALUE
20 or more units 2,597 9.6   Less than $50,000 43 0.4
Mobile home 422 1.6   $50,000 to $99,999 562 4.8
Boat, RV, van, etc. 20 0.1   $100,000 to $149,999 2,347 19.9
        $150,000 to $199,000 3,929 33.4
YEAR STRUCTURE BUILT       $200,000 to $299,999 3,625 30.8
1999 to March 2000 578 2.1   $300,000 to $499,999 1,082 9.2
1995 to 1998 788 2.9   $500,000 to $999,999 171 1.5
1990 to 1994 967 3.6   $1,000,000 or more 20 0.2
1980 to 1989 4,393 16.2   Median (dollars) 186,500 (x)
1970 to 1979 4,694 17.3        
1960 to 1969 4,378 16.1   MORTGAGE STATUS AND SELECTED MONTHLY OWNER COSTS
1940 to 1959 5,778 21.3        
1939 or earlier 5,607 20.6   With a mortgage 8,802 74.7
             Less than $300 0 0.0
 ROOMS            $300 to $499 53 0.4
1 room 732 2.7        $500 to $699 183 1.6
2 rooms 1,385 5.1        $700 to $999 876 7.4
3 rooms 3,288 12.1        $1,000 to $1,499 3,376 28.7
4 rooms 4,917 18.1        $1,500 to $1,999 2,656 22.5
5 rooms 5,102 18.8        $2,000 or more 1,658 14.1
6 rooms 4,417 16.2        Median (dollars) 1,489 (x)
7 rooms 3,260 12.0   Not mortgaged 2,977 25.3
8 rooms 2,217 8.2        Median (dollars) 450 (x)
9 or more rooms 1,865 6.9        
Median (rooms) 5.1 (x)   SELECTED MONTHLY OWNER COSTS AS A PERCENTAGE OF HOUSEHOLD INCOME IN 1999
          Occupied Housing Units

27,183 100.0        
YEAR HOUSEHOLDER MOVED INTO UNIT Less than 15 percent 3,506 29.8
1999 to March 2000 5,603 20.6   15 to 19 percent 2,030 17.2
1995 to 1998 8,459 31.1   20 to 24 percent 1,822 15.5
1990 to 1994 4,001 14.7   25 to 29 percent 1,417 12.0
1980 to 1989 3,886 14.3   30 to 34 percent 812 6.9
1970 to 1979 2,402 8.8   35 percent or more 2,133 18.1
1969 or earlier 2,832 10.4   Not computed 59 0.5
             
VEHICLES AVAILABLE                 Specified renter-occupied units 11,339 100.0
None 2,112 7.8   GROSS RENT    
1 9,242 34.0   Less than $200 426 3.8
2 11,257 41.4   $200 to $299 529 4.7
3 or more 4,572 16.8   $300 to $499 1,043 9.2
        $500 to $749 2,697 23.8
HOUSE HEATING FUEL       $750 to $999 3,592 31.7
Utility Gas 6,935 25.5   $1,000 to $1,499 2,372 20.9
Bottled, Tank, or LP gas 800 2.9   $1,500 or more 412 3.6
Electricity 8,434 31.0   No cash rent 268 2.4
Fuel oil, kerosene, etc. 10,773 39.6   Median (dollars) 818 (x)
Coal or coke 9 0.0        
Wood 98 0.4   GROSS RENT AS A PERCENTAGE OF HOUSEHOLD INCOME IN 1999
Solar energy 0 0.0        
Other fuel 83 0.3   Less than 15 percent 2,018 17.8
No fuel used 51 0.2   15 to 19 percent 2,137 18.8
        20 to 24 percent 1,637 14.4
SELECTED CHARACTERISTICS       25 to 29 percent 1,381 12.2
Lacking complete plumbing facilities 265 1.0   30 to 34 percent 844 7.4
Lacking complete kitchen facilities 204 0.8   35 percent or more 2,889 25.5
No telephone service 182 0.7   Not computed 433 3.8


- Represents zero or rounds to zero.          (X) Not applicable.          Source: U.S. Bureau of the Census, Census 2000.
